结绳编程的语法规则是什么

worktile 其他 93

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    结绳编程是一种基于图形化编程的教育工具,它的语法规则相对简单易懂。下面是结绳编程的几个基本语法规则:

    1. 块语句:结绳编程中的程序由一个个块语句组成。每个块语句代表一个指令或操作,如移动、转向、循环等。

    2. 连接块:在结绳编程中,不同的块语句可以通过连接块来连接起来,形成一个完整的程序流程。连接块有输入块和输出块两种类型,分别用于接收和传递数据。

    3. 控制流程:结绳编程中可以使用控制流程来实现条件判断和循环。例如,可以使用条件块来判断某个条件是否满足,如果满足则执行某个操作,否则执行其他操作。还可以使用循环块来重复执行一段程序。

    4. 变量和数据类型:结绳编程支持变量的使用,可以创建和修改变量的值。常见的数据类型包括整数、浮点数、字符串等。

    5. 函数和过程:结绳编程中可以定义函数和过程,用于封装一段特定的功能代码。函数和过程可以被其他块调用,提高代码的复用性。

    需要注意的是,结绳编程的语法规则因不同的编程工具而有所差异,上述规则仅为一般性描述。在具体使用结绳编程工具时,可以参考相应的使用手册或教程,了解具体的语法规则和使用方法。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    结绳编程是一种通过将绳子绑成不同的结构来表示编程逻辑的一种编程方式。与传统的文本编程语言不同,结绳编程使用物理结构来表示代码的执行流程和控制逻辑。下面是结绳编程的一些语法规则:

    1. 结构表示:不同的结构代表不同的编程逻辑,例如循环、条件判断、函数调用等。常见的结构包括环、桥、分支等。

    2. 结绳颜色:不同颜色的绳子代表不同的数据类型或变量。例如,红色的绳子可以表示整数,蓝色的绳子可以表示字符串,黄色的绳子可以表示布尔值等。

    3. 结绳连接:通过将绳子连接在一起来表示数据的流动和传递。例如,将一个绳子连接到另一个绳子的末端,可以表示将一个变量的值传递给另一个变量。

    4. 结绳节点:绳子的交叉点被称为节点,节点可以表示不同的操作或函数。例如,两个节点之间的绳子可以表示函数的调用。

    5. 结绳顺序:绳子的排列顺序表示代码的执行顺序。例如,绳子从左到右表示代码从上到下的执行顺序。

    需要注意的是,结绳编程的语法规则可以根据具体的实现方式和编程环境而有所不同。以上是一些常见的语法规则,但具体的绳结编程工具和平台可能会有自己的规则和约定。因此,在使用结绳编程时,需要详细了解所使用的工具和平台的语法规则。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    结绳编程是一种基于图形化编程的教育工具,主要用于教授编程概念和逻辑思维。它的语法规则相对简单,适合初学者学习。

    1. 块的连接规则:结绳编程中,程序是由一个个块构成的。块之间通过连接来表示程序的执行顺序。一般来说,块之间的连接分为以下几种类型:
    • 顺序连接:块按照从上到下的顺序执行。
    • 条件连接:根据条件的真假决定执行的路径。通常使用条件判断块来表示。
    • 循环连接:多次执行同一块或一组块。通常使用循环块来表示。
    1. 块的参数设置:结绳编程中,每个块可以有不同的参数设置,用来控制块的行为。参数可以是数字、文本、布尔值等。

    2. 事件和动作:结绳编程中,程序的执行通常是由事件和动作触发的。事件是指程序运行过程中发生的事情,如按钮点击、键盘输入等。动作是指程序执行的操作,如显示文本、播放声音等。

    3. 变量和数据类型:结绳编程中,可以使用变量来存储和处理数据。变量可以是数字、文本、布尔值等不同的数据类型。

    4. 函数和过程:结绳编程中,可以使用函数和过程来封装一段代码,以便复用和模块化。函数是指带有返回值的代码块,过程是指不带返回值的代码块。

    5. 错误处理:结绳编程中,可以使用错误处理来处理程序运行过程中可能出现的错误。通常使用错误处理块来表示。

    总之,结绳编程的语法规则相对简单,主要是通过块的连接和参数设置来表示程序的逻辑。初学者可以通过简单的拖拽和连接来完成编程任务,无需关注具体的语法细节。这使得结绳编程成为一种非常适合初学者学习编程的工具。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部